Rohit Sharma named India captain for T20Is against New Zealand

Rohit Sharma will take on the T20I captaincy reins from Virat Kohli for the upcoming series against New Zealand. The Board of Control for Cricket in India (BCCI) announced the squad for the series on Tuesday. Virat Kohli, for whom the T20 World Cup was the last assignment as T20I captain has been rested. KL Rahul, meanwhile, has been named as vice-captain. Hardik Pandya, Mohammed Shami, Jasprit Bumrah and Ravindra Jadeja, all four of whom played the recently-concluded T20 World Cup, have also been rested.

A few new faces have also been named in the squad. Kolkata Knight Riders’ Venkatesh Iyer and Chennai Super Kings’ Ruturaj Gaikwad, both of whom scored plenty of runs at the 2021 Indian Premier League, have been included in the squad. Iyer impressed with his all-round performances – with the bat he scored 370 runs at an average of 41.11 and strike rate of 128.47, while with the ball he picked up three wickets from 10 matches. Gaikwad, on the other hand, was the highest run-scorer in IPL 2021 with 635 runs at an average and strike rate of 45.35 and 136.26 respectively.

Royal Challengers Bangalore’s Harshal Patel, the highest wicket-taker of IPL 2021, has also received a call-up. Mohammed Siraj and Yuzvendra Chahal, meanwhile, have been recalled. India will host New Zealand for 3 T20Is starting from 17th November in Rajkot. The second and third T20I will be played in Ranchi and Kolkata respectively. The series will also mark the start of Rahul Dravid’s tenure as India’s head coach after Ravi Shastri’s term ended at the recent T20 World Cup.

Full squad for the New Zealand series: Rohit Sharma (Captain), KL Rahul (Vice-Captain), Ruturaj Gaikwad, Shreyas Suryakumar Yadav, Rishabh Pant (wicket-keeper), Ishan Kishan (wicket-keeper), Venkatesh Iyer, Yuzvendra Chahal, R Ashwin, Axar Patel, Avesh Khan, Bhuvneshwar Kumar, Deepak Chahar, Harshal Patel, Mohammed Siraj

India A Squad for South Africa Series Announced

The BCCI also announced a squad for India ‘A’ that will tour South Africa for three four-day matches starting on November 23 in Bloemfontein. Umran Malik, who impressed with his pace in the few games he played in IPL 2021, has been named in the squad. Priyank Panchal will lead the side which also has the likes of Prithvi Shaw, Navdeep Saini, Rahul Chahar and Ishan Porel.

Full Squad: Priyank Panchal (Captain), Prithvi Shaw, Abhimanyu Easwaran, Devdutt Padikkal, Sarfaraz Khan, Baba Aparajith, Upendra Yadav (wicket-keeper), K Gowtham, Rahul Chahar, Saurabh Kumar, Navdeep Saini, Umran Malik, Ishan Porel, Arzan Nagwaswalla
